How Reliable is the Vauxhall Antara?

Based on 362,535 MOT tests across 26,838 vehicles.

72.8%
Pass Rate
6,611
Miles/Year
19
Year Lifespan
26,838
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

position lamp(s) not working 3,890
Registration plate lamp not working 3,438
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 2,940
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 2,940

SH62 XTO is a 2012 Vauxhall Antara in Black with a 2,231c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2012 Vauxhall Antara models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.8% with a typical mileage of 61,996 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Antara f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 3,890 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SH62 XTO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Antara typ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 14 years old, this Vauxhall Antara is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
